Arabescato marble is exclusively extracted from quarries located in Italy, particularly in the Carrara area, Tuscany region, which is worldwide known for producing various types of high-quality white marble including Carrara marble, Statuario marble, and Calacatta marble.
Is Arabescato marble good as kitchen countertops?
Arabescato marble is absolutely a stunning choice for a kitchen countertop , island or splashback due to its unparalleled beauty and luxurious appearance. Its striking veining adds a touch of elegance to your kitchen creating a unique space. Arabescato Marble requires more attention and care compared to granite. However, by regularly sealing its surface and taking the due care you can easily maintain its pristine appearance.
What is Arabescato marble?
Arabescato marble is a type of marble characterized by a pure white color with grey or dark elegant busy veins running through its slab surface. Arabescato marble is quarried primarily in Italy, in the same area where Carrara marble, Statuario marble and Calacatta marble are quarried. It is highly prized for its beauty and unique veining patterns, making it a popular choice for kitchen countertops, flooring, wall cladding, and as design furnitures like marble dining tables.
